BENCHMARK_SUITE = m2s-bench-amdapp-2.5
TARBALL_NAME = $(BENCHMARK_SUITE).tar.gz
M2S_ROOT = $(HOME)/multi2sim
M2S_LIB = $(M2S_ROOT)/lib/.libs
M2S_BIN = $(M2S_ROOT)/bin
M2S_INCLUDE = $(M2S_ROOT)/runtime/include
M2S_DEVICE = "Tahiti"
CFLAGS = "-I../include -I. -I../common -I$(M2S_INCLUDE) -g"
LDFLAGS_STATIC = "-L$(M2S_LIB) -lm2s-opencl -lpthread -ldl -lrt -static -m32"
LDFLAGS_DYNAMIC = "-L$(M2S_LIB) -lm2s-opencl -lpthread -ldl -lrt -m32"
all: premake
dist: premake $(TARBALL_NAME)
clean:
for subdir in $(SUBDIRS); do \
make -C $$subdir clean || exit 1; \
done
rm -f $(TARBALL_NAME)
premake:
make -C $(M2S_ROOT)/runtime/opencl
for subdir in $(SUBDIRS); do \
make -C $$subdir \
M2S_ROOT=$(M2S_ROOT) \
M2S_LIB=$(M2S_LIB) \
M2S_BIN=$(M2S_BIN) \
M2S_INCLUDE=$(M2S_INCLUDE) \
M2S_DEVICE=$(M2S_DEVICE) \
CFLAGS=$(CFLAGS) \
LDFLAGS_STATIC=$(LDFLAGS_STATIC) \
LDFLAGS_DYNAMIC=$(LDFLAGS_DYNAMIC) \
M2C=$(M2C) \
|| exit 1; \
done
$(TARBALL_NAME): $(OPENCL_BINARIES) $(KERNEL_BINARIES)
rm -f $(TARBALL_NAME)
tar -czvf $(TARBALL_NAME) --transform='s,^,$(BENCHMARK_SUITE)/,' $(OPENCL_BINARIES) \
$(KERNEL_BINARIES) $(EXTRA_DIST)
